sway bar links are used up. strut doesnt look like its a leaker but they look like they have some miles on em. trailing arm looks a little tweaked. brake pads look used up and the parking brake cable is close to breaking
 
your sway bar is 1/2 broken and the end links are toast. lca's look rusty, but you need to check the bushings, tire off look at them, the arm will push down, and you can see just how torn up they are or not.

the rear looks pretty rusty as well, but if its all tight, id leave it till it needs to be changed.

rotors look like they were sitting out side for years on end in a back yard lol new brakes could be done as well if the pads are low get at em, if not you could let them slide for a while tho.

yes the bar the ties into the lca's via the end links, it looks like a curling bar at the gym lol

any way you can just get a dorman solid sway bar, it comes with all new hardware, end links, caps bolts and bushings.

at the parts store they can be as much as 120. but if you shop on line you can find them for 80 and up.
